Sheriff's Sale of
Real Estate
2784 River Street Grove City, OH 43123
Common Pleas Court
Franklin County, Ohio
No. 25CV5234 --- LoanDepot.Com, LLC PLAINTIFF VS. Lori Sayre et al. DEFENDANT
In pursuance of an Order of Sale from said Court to me directed, I will offer for advertising beginning on April 21st, 2026 at public auction, in accordance with ORC Section 2329.153, online @ https://franklin.sh
eriffsaleauction.ohio.gov on Friday, May 22nd, 2026 at 9:00 o'clock A.M., and if not then sold, on June 12th 2026 at 9:00 o'clock A.M., the following described real estate, situated in the County of Franklin and State of Ohio, and in the Township of Pleasant:

Improved with 2 story 6 room frame dwelling with 2 car detached garage.
Known as 2784 River Street Grove City, OH 43123 – PARCEL NO. 230-001280.
Appraised at $ 219,000.00.
The appraisal was completed based on an exterior view of the property only.
Terms of sale: First Sale - To be sold at https://franklin.sheriffsale
auction.ohio.gov for not less than two-thirds of the appraised value.
Second Sale - If the property does not sell at the first auction, a second sale of this property will be held on June 12th, 2026. The second sale shall be made without regard to the minimum bid requirements in ORC Section 2329.20, but shall be subject to costs, allowance and taxes under ORC Section 2329.21.
$ 10,000.00 deposit which must be on account with Realauction (See online sale/bidding instructions). Balance cashier’s check only within thirty days after confirmation. ORC Section 2327.02(C) requires successful bidders pay recording and conveyance fees to the Sheriff at the time of sale.
